Dogs give birth through a process called whelping. The key stages of the birthing process for dogs include the onset of labor, the delivery of puppies, and the expulsion of the placenta. During labor, the dog may exhibit nesting behavior and panting. The delivery stage involves the actual birth of the puppies, which can take several hours. After each puppy is born, the mother will typically clean them and sever the umbilical cord. The final stage is the expulsion of the placenta, which usually occurs after each puppy is born. It is important to monitor the mother and puppies closely during the birthing process to ensure their health and safety.

What is the birth process for dogs?

The birth process for dogs, also known as whelping, typically involves three stages: the first stage involves restlessness and nesting behavior, the second stage is labor where contractions occur and puppies are born, and the third stage involves the passing of the placenta. It is important to monitor the mother closely during this process and seek veterinary assistance if there are any complications.

What happen if tne dog give a birth and finish to giving birth and still something came out from her body?

Like humans, dogs have an after birth. After birth is the birth of the placenta. The placenta is what surronds the baby or in this case puppys during birth and protects them. How do dogs engage in sexual reproduction?

Dogs engage in sexual reproduction through a process called mating, where a male dog mounts a female dog and inserts his penis into her vagina to transfer sperm. This process allows for fertilization of the female's eggs, leading to the possibility of pregnancy and the birth of puppies.
